Understanding Asian Eye Shape

Suppose you’re considering getting eyelash extensions for your Asian eyes. In that case, it’s important to understand the unique features of your eye shape and how they can impact the results of your lash extensions. Unlike Western eyes, Asian eyes tend to have less visible eyelid space and a flatter brow bone, which can affect the placement and curl of lash extensions.

However, with the right techniques and solutions, achieving beautiful and natural-looking lash extensions for Asian eyes is possible. Here are some tips and insights to help you achieve the best possible results:

Choosing the Right Extension Length and Curl

When selecting the length and curl of your lash extensions, it’s important to consider the natural shape of your eyes and lashes. While longer and more dramatic extensions may be suitable for some eye shapes, they can overwhelm and weigh down Asian eyes, resulting in an unnatural or droopy appearance.

A skilled lash technician will consider the shape of your eyes, the length and thickness of your natural lashes, and your desired look to create a customized lash extension style that flatters your features. They may also use different curl types to enhance the appearance of your lashes and create a more lifted and defined eye shape.

Using the Right Technique and Adhesive

The application technique and adhesive used for lash extensions can also affect the results for Asian eyes. Traditional Western lash extension techniques may not work well for Asian eyes due to the differences in eye shape and eyelid structure.

The “Asian method” has been developed to suit the needs of Asian eyes better. This method involves applying shorter extensions to the outer corners and longer extensions to the centre of the lash line to create a more natural-looking and eye-opening effect.

Using a high-quality adhesive that is safe and suitable for Asian eyes is also important. Some adhesives may cause irritation or discomfort, especially for sensitive eyes or skin.

Popular eyelash extension styles for Asian eyes

When choosing the right eyelash extensions for Asian eyes, many options exist. The best style for you depends on your eye shape and the look you want to achieve. Here are some popular options:

StyleDescription
NaturalThese extensions focus on lengthening and defining your natural lashes without adding too much volume. They’re ideal if you want to enhance your lashes without looking too dramatic.
WispyWispy extensions feature a mix of thin and thick lashes that are layered to create a fluttery, textured look. This style is great if you want a subtle boost of volume and definition.
Doll EyeDoll eye extensions are longer on the outer corners and shorter on the inner corners, creating a wide-eyed, feminine look. This style can help balance out almond or downturned eyes.
DramaticFor a bold, high-impact look, dramatic extensions feature thicker and longer lashes that create a full and glamorous effect. This style is perfect for special occasions or if you want to make a statement with your eye makeup.

No matter which style you choose, it’s important to consult with your lash technician to ensure that the extensions are tailored to your unique eye shape and preferences.

Tips for maintaining and caring for Asian eye lash extensions

Getting eyelash extensions can be a game-changer for your daily routine and overall look, but For them to look their best, they need to be cared for and maintained properly. Here are some tips that are made just for Asian eyes:

Cleansing routine

It’s crucial to establish a proper cleansing routine to keep your lash extensions hygienic and looking their best. Use a gentle, oil-free cleanser and avoid rubbing or pulling at your lashes. Instead, gently cleanse them with a soft brush or applicator, being careful not to dislodge any extensions.

Avoid moisture and oil

Avoid exposing your lash extensions to excess moisture or oil, as this can weaken the adhesive and cause them to fall out prematurely. Avoid getting them wet for at least 24 hours after application and avoid oil-based products around the eye area.

Protect while sleeping

Protect your lash extensions while sleeping by using a cushion made of silk or satin to reduce friction avoid sleeping on your side or stomach, which can cause your lashes to rub against the pillow.

Regular fills

Depending on the type of lashes you choose and your natural lash cycle, you’ll need to schedule regular fills to maintain your extensions. Typically, fills are necessary every 2-3 weeks to make sure you have full, thick eyelashes and to replace any that fall out.

TIP: Be sure to schedule your fills in advance, as many lash technicians can get booked up quickly, especially during busy seasons or holidays!

Watch for reactions

Even though it doesn’t happen often, some people may be allergic to or sensitive to the glue used in lash extensions. If you notice any swelling, burning, or pain, you should call your lash expert right away so they can look at the problem and maybe take the extensions off or fix them.

Common concerns and misconceptions about eyelash extensions in Asian eyes

If you’re considering getting eyelash extensions for your Asian eyes, you may have some concerns or misconceptions about the process and results. Here are some of the most common issues that clients raise:

  1. Will eyelash extensions be effective on my Asian eyes?
  2. Yes, eyelash extensions can be very effective on Asian eyes. However, it’s essential to choose a skilled and experienced lash technician who understands the unique features of Asian eyes and can customize the extensions accordingly. With the right application and care, you can achieve stunning results that enhance your natural beauty.
  3.  Are there any solutions to the challenges of applying lash extensions to Asian eyes?
  4. Yes, there are several solutions to the challenges of applying eyelash extensions to Asian eyes. For example, using shorter and lighter extensions can help avoid weighing down the lashes and creating a droopy effect. Additionally, using a curl that complements your eye shape, such as a slight “C” curl, can create a more lifted and defined look.
  5.  Will eyelash extensions damage my natural lashes or irritate my eyes?
  6. When applied and cared for correctly, eyelash extensions should not damage your natural lashes or irritate your eyes. However, if the extensions are too heavy or incorrectly applied, they can cause strain on your natural lashes and lead to breakage or premature shedding. It’s crucial to choose a technician who uses high-quality products and follows safe application procedures.
  7.  Are lash extensions right for me if I have fine or sparse lashes?
  8. Yes, eyelash extensions can be an excellent option for those with fine or sparse lashes, because they can add length and depth to make a fuller and more defined look. A skilled technician can customize the extensions to suit your natural lashes and create a seamless and natural-looking result.
  9.  Do I need to avoid certain activities or products after getting lash extensions?

Yes, it’s essential to follow proper aftercare instructions to ensure the longevity and health of your lash extensions. This may include avoiding oil-based products, excessive rubbing or touching of the eyes, and exposure to steam or heat. Your technician can provide you with specific recommendations based on your eye shape, skin type, and lifestyle.
